Sub-jail superintendent held for taking bribe

March 30, 2016 12:00 am | Updated 05:44 am IST - BERHAMPUR:

Superintendent of Digapahandi sub-jail in Ganjam district of Odisha, Bibhuti Bhusan Patnaik, was arrested by vigilance officials on Tuesday while he was accepting Rs.10,000 from a supplier of grocery items to the jail.

This Shankarsana Khuntia had approached the Berhampur vigilance division when the sub-jail superintendent demanded bribe to pass his pending bills for goods supplied and to influence chairman of the tender committee of the jail to issue necessary instructions so that the supplier could supply dal.

Khuntia has been supplying grocery items to the sub-jail since 2009. This year also he had participated in the tender process and received orders to supply 95 items, excluding dal. When the complainant approached Patnaik, he allegedly demanded Rs.10,000.

Basing on the complaint of Khuntia, vigilance sleuths set up a trap on Tuesday. Patnaik was caught while accepting the currency notes marked with phenolphthalein at his residence.
